Summary
Graduation season in the US sees a surprising trend: students booing AI. Videos of these moments go viral, showing students expressing discontent with AI, especially as they face the job market. This pushback is a clear sign of growing concerns about AIs integration into education and careers. The tension peaks at Glendale Community College, where an AI system fails to display correct names, leading to boos and a preference for human announcers. This backlash highlights the complex terrain universities and students are navigating, with AIs potential to boost learning and creativity balanced against concerns about its impact on foundational skills and academic integrity.
